What is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online betting platform that supports Cryptocurrency Casino as a primary method for deposits, withdrawals, and gameplay. Unlike traditional online casinos that rely on banking organizations, credit cards, or e-wallets, crypto gambling establishments utilize blockchain technology to help with transactions.
These platforms fall into two primary classifications:
- Pure Crypto Casinos: These websites operate specifically with cryptocurrencies, offering unparalleled privacy and fast deal speeds.
- Hybrid Casinos: These platforms accept both traditional f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, and so on) and cryptocurrencies, accommodating a more comprehensive audience that may choose a mix of payment approaches.

3. Provably Fair Gaming
This is maybe the most considerable innovation in the crypto casino area. Through cryptographic algorithms, players can independently confirm the outcome of a video game to ensure it hasn't been tampered with. This transparency replaces the "trust-me" design of conventional casinos with empirical evidence.

Security and Best Practices
While crypto gaming offers modern security, users should stay watchful. The decentralized nature of crypto suggests that if a user loses their private keys or sends funds to the wrong address, the money is frequently unrecoverable.
Security Checklist:
- Use Reputable Platforms: Always inspect for a legitimate betting license (e.g., Curacao, Malta).
- Enable 2FA: Two-Factor Authentication is non-negotiable for both your casino account and your individual crypto wallet.
- Use Cold Storage: Never keep big amounts of crypto on a casino account. Withdraw earnings regularly to a safe hardware wallet.
- Look For Provably Fair Tags: Look for the "Provably Fair" seal on video game titles to ensure the website runs transparently.

What are "Provably Fair" video games?
Provably level playing fields enable you to use a hash algorithm to verify that the seed used to produce an outcome has not been controlled after the truth. It ensures that the casino might not have modified the result of your bet.
